Situated 7.5 mls through the border between Portugal and Spain, the garrison city of Elvas in Portugal has been included in a list of UNESCO World Historical past web sites. Constructed like a reply to the Spanish stronghold of Badajoz, this hilltop city was among Portugal's mightiest frontier posts for a long time. This town was originally re-grabbed in the Moors in 1230, withstanding numerous episodes from Spain throughout the pursuing 3 hundreds of years. In the warfare of Self-sufficiency between Portugal and Spain from 1640-1668 this town was defeated through the Spanish but was later alleviated through the Portuguese. In additional recent times the city was applied through the Duke of Wellington as his head office within his siege of the Spanish city of Badajoz.
The town's celebrity-designed wall surfaces which completely surrounded the town and supplied protection from all aspects of attack and forts are some of the most sophisticated and finest safeguarded armed forces fortifications which still make it through in The european countries. The magnificently preserved 17th century Fort de Santa Luzia towards the north of your older town as well as the Amoreira Aqueduct are perhaps both the very best preserved websites in Elvas. The imposing Amoreira Aqueduct is 4.5 kilometers in length, above 100ft full of some places, required a lot more than a hundred years to complete yet still holds drinking water on the village.
Originally built in 1226, the Cathedral Nossa Senhora da Assuncao continues to be produced bigger along with a great deal of changes in their life time. The Church of Nossa Senhora dos Aflitos may have a very basic outside but this Templar chapel includes a spectacular internal lined with 17th century ceramic tiles that attain great to the cupola (dome).
Near by is really a Manueline marble pillory with metallic hooks which functions as a prompt in the penalties metered out in older occasions. Based in the bastion of Sao Joao da Corujeiro may be the most ancient British armed forces cemetery in European countries. Here you will find regimental plaques which report the demise of members of the military servicing with British Regiments throughout the Fight of Albuhera in 1811 and also the sieges of Badajoz.
To the north-eastern of Elvas will be the town of Campo Major (greater field). Here you will discover the morbid Chapel Capelo dos Ossos that goes back to 1766. The complete experience of your chapel is protected with human being bones which serve as a prompt of the 1500 people destroyed when super struck the fortress here where gunpowder was saved. Busy by French troops through the French attack, this town was soon relieved by Lord Beresford who guided an Anglo-Portuguese attack around the French occupiers.
Even though the town includes a sad historical past it can be now a happy position where townsfolk observe using a festivity each year. In the festivity the thin streets are covered with a roofing created from a large number of papers blossoms under which the people enjoy parades and grooving. Every street in the community secretly decorates their road trying to win a reward. This yearly function attracts folks from all of above, especially from Spain.
